To better characterize the role of the lipoprotein lipase (LPL) gene in the determination of triglyceride levels in healthy subjects, a study was performed in 193 nuclear families (384 parents, means age = 42.0 2 5.2 years; 399 offspring, mean age = 14.6 2 4.3 years) volunteering to have a free heal
